“A great budget hotel”
3 of 5 stars Reviewed 25 February 2007
2
people found this review helpful

What you need to remember here is this is a budget hotel, having read some other reviews they don't seem to have taken this into account as at the end of the day you get what you pay for... We stayed here for 3 nights in a triple room costing us just £22 a night each. For this we got a clean room with a bathroom right next to the Termini Station (very handy for getting the metro and buses). Our first impressions of the hotel were not great, it is situated on the second floor of an old building and after climbing up a few flights of concrete dismal looking stairs we were worried about what we had quite let ourselves in for! However the entrance to the hotel is very nice and the free internet was very useful. The staff were very friendly and spoke English well, even taught us a bit of Italian. Our room had 2 singles and a double bed, and was just big enough to fit these in plus a wardrobe and desk. One of the singles had obviously been added as there were 3 of us, but it was so uncomfortable I didn't even bother trying to sleep on it and 2 of us ended up in the double. The other 2 beds were comfortable. The bathroom was clean and functional with a nice hot shower. Yes it was not perfect, for example the toilet wasn't that easy to flush but totally acceptable for the money. The maid came in each morning and folded our pyjamas and made the beds but didn't clean the bathroom. My one disappointment about the room was the window, it looked out into a small square in the middle of the building and it really wasn't a pleasant view, the shutters were hard to open and there was a lack of natural light at times, but hey we were only there to sleep... I slept very well (having walked miles around Rome) despite the shouts of some noisey Italians heard from the small square and a rather vocal pigeon outside the window. Overall the hotel was friendly, clean and what was expected for a budget 2 star accommodation although if I go back to Rome next time I think I will spend a little more for something better.

“No problems here....”
3 of 5 stars Reviewed 30 May 2006
9
people found this review helpful

I stayed at the Hotel Urbis in May 2006, we stayed for 2 nights, and could not find fault at all with the hotel. It is a budget property, and that is exactly what you are paying for. Very close to Termini, you can see the main entrance as soon as you walk out the front door. The bus service and metro to anywhere in the city all depart from Termini, so very convienent. Tons of cheap shopping and excellent restaurants in the area as well. We were a family of 3 sisters. We each had our own single beds, and yes, there were not heavenly beds, but it was a clean place to rest your head after seeing and walking all over the city. The shower was clean, and we didnt experience anything falling apart or breaking. The staff was friendly, and helped book a tour for us. If you are looking for a luxury hotel, I would suggest paying a small fortune for another hotel. I would rather enjoy my money on food, wine, and fun, than to pay for a hotel room I am only in for a few hours a night. Stay at the Urbis if you dont mind a hotel like a Knights Inn, or a Super 8.
